was thinking it would be nice to have a bit more flexibility in order issuing. without getting to complex.

such as being able to tell your squad to go somewhere and not regroup afterwards. so you could have them defend a point of interest, or take a sniping position. while you do other things.

and being able to have you squad pick up different guns. so you could create a team of silenced smgs to go raiding with you, or what not.

was thinking both these could be done by holding down the order button for over a second, as they wouldn't be split second decision orders. and it wouldn't require more keys.


------------------------------------------------------------------------
also saw a post a while back about breaking down your squad to give individual orders, and how to go about that.

my thought would be breaking them down to fire-teams that are assigned a number (1-4), that you would give them rts stile by hovering your mouse over them, holding alt(or whatever) and pressing the corresponding number key.

then you could command each fire-team individual with 1 touch of a button by just taping the number key(1-4) and they would move to the current mouse location.

Maby the constantly having to re-assigned squad members after one dies slows down game-play to much.


but I still like the idea of telling my hmg troop to take up cover behind a wall and provide suppression fire while the rest of the team flanks.
or having a sniper take a position on a roof to cover a street.
or having just silenced smgs fallow me
and when medics come in, I probably will just want them to hide and try not to die.

and maby that's a solution, each key 1-4 refers to a type of troop:

f1)- assault {all asult rifles, shotguns ext)
f2)- hmgs { and any other unit that needs to set up}
f3) - snipers
f4) - support units {medics, mortar men or whatever gets added}
f5) - stealth {silenced smgs (witch could also be part of assult)}

that way when they inevitably die you don't have to reassign anything.

and a 1key order keeps things fast and fluid.
